Plastic Bottles.
Thank you for supporting the recycling in the Village Hall barrels. This is ONLY for plastic bottles with 1 or 2 in the recycling triangle.
No yoghurt pots, food trays, ice cream tubs or other plastic - PLEASE.
If you are going to a recycling tip, please take any bottles that have accumulated at the Village Hall.

Flicks in the Sticks
Autumn 2010 season:
21 Sep Amazing Grace: The story of William Wilberforce, the slavery abolitionist. Starring Michael Gambon, Albert Finney & Ioan Gruffudd. 2006
5 Oct A Man for All Seasons: The life of Thomas More, who stood up to Henry VIII. With Paul Scofield. 1966. Winner of 6 Academy Awards. Dir. Fred Zinnemann
26 Oct Atanarjuat- The Fast Runner: A superbly filmed story of an Inuit Legend of an evil spirit causing strife in the community & its battle with an Inuit warrior
2 Nov The Girl with the Dragon Tattoo: 1st of Stieg Larsson’s trilogy. Financial journalist Mikael Blomkvist and the tattooed computer hacker Lisbeth Salander investigate.
23 Nov I’ve Loved You so Long: French film with an intriguing plot & fantastic performance by Kristin Scott Thomas. 2008
30 Nov Baaria: Dir: Giuseppe Tornatore (also directed Cinema Paradiso). Autobiographical story of 3 generations living in Tornatore’s Sicilian village. 2009
14 Dec Cabaret: Sinister musical comedy set in pre WWII Germany. With Liza Minneli & Michael York . 1972. Winner of 8 Oscars
 
 
 
 
All films start at 7:30pm unless stated. Light refreshments are on sale. No under 16s are allowed. Film nights can be sponsored - see Sue for details.
